VOGELSANG v. DELTA AIR LINES, INC.


193 F.Supp. 613 (1961)

Joseph VOGELSANG and George Schmits, co-partners doing business under the firm name and style of Whitehouse Bros., Plaintiffs, v. DELTA AIR LINES, INC., Defendant.

United States District Court S. D. New York.

April 10, 1961.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Greenhill & Speyer, New York City, Simon Greenhill, New York City, of counsel, for plaintiffs.

Bigham, Englar, Jones & Houston, New York City, John L. Conners, New York City, of counsel, for defendant.


SUGARMAN, District Judge.

Defendant Delta Air Lines, Inc., moves for a summary judgment in its favor in an action brought against it for the negligent loss by defendant of one of two two bags owned by plaintiffs and checked with movant in connection with the air transportation of George Schmits, one of the plaintiffs.

As alternative relief, defendant asks for the entry of a judgment in plaintiffs' favor in the sum of $100, the limit of defendant's liability...
